WebMedicines commonly used for simple UTI s include: Trimethoprim and sulfamethoxazole (Bactrim, Bactrim DS) Fosfomycin (Monurol) Nitrofurantoin (Macrodantin, Macrobid, Furadantin) Cephalexin Ceftriaxone The group of antibiotics known as fluoroquinolones isn't commonly recommended for simple UTI s.
